This study reports on the pilot of a destination simulation game in a first year subject of a tourism and hospitality undergraduate degree. Firstly alignment of the learning outcomes of the subject with the pilot will be assessed then observations relating to the implementation of the pilot are detailed. Finally challenges and implications for expanding the project into higher levels are identified.
